Falling Waters a design firm focused on the ongoing relationship between people, site, built-structures, and plants. The harmony between Architecture and landscape is integral to the health and beauty of our environment; it is the responsibility of the landscape designer to respond and react to what nature provides. As designers and shapers of the built environment we have a responsibility to nature to be a part of the solution and not the problem. In every project, all effort is put forth to be respectful to the landscape.
